 Dopolgy: On How they Recycled 6,000 Newspapers Into 10,000 Pencils. |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 2074

On this Episode of multipurpose, I sat down with Akshata from dopology This is a story of a couple, who wanted to embark on a journey of being entrepreneurs. Though they were small, they made a difference. Thus was born Dopolgy - more as a way of life. It is all about making small changes in your life and the products you use to make a huge difference to nature. With this thought, we dived headon with just a small list of products - Newspaper Pencils, Newspaper Seed Pencils, Newspaper Colour Pencils, Seed Bombs, Bamboo Toothbrushes, and Natural Loofah.

 Ankit Puri : On How Being Vegan Made A Difference In His Life. |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 1668

Ankit Puri Have Been volunteering at animal shelters and environmental NGOs since the age of 15, he founded Voiceless India in 2017 with the vision to create a change in society’s perception of non-human beings and spreading the message of climate action. In 2018, he was recognized with the DLF Pramerica Award for Social Service. Recently, he represented his organization at the Vegan India Conference 2019 held in New Delhi and was recently invited as a panelist at a Panel Discussion on Social Entrepreneurship at Christ (Deemed to be University) as well as an NGO Partner at Christ (Bannerghatta). Under Voiceless India, they conduct Workshops with students of schools and colleges such as NPS, Pathways, Christ University, etc, to spread the message of compassion and sustainability, sterilization drives for dogs, reflective collar drives, cleanliness drives, and many more activities.

 Padmanabha Arkalgudand: On how helping others changed his life. | File Type: audio/x-m4a | Duration: 1780

On this episode of Multi Purpose, I sat down with  Padmanabha Arkalgudand is  the Founder President of Citizens Forum Yelahanka, a travel enthusiast and a veteran theatre person, who went back to the stage after 50 years in 2011. He has always been associated with several social causes and in his capacity as VP, Bhadrachalam Paper Boards, had implemented the Drinking Water Project for Sarapaka, a village with a population of 10,000, which he calls the ‘best contribution to my country in my life.’ Post retirement, he has been a consultant with ITC and Christian Medical Association of India, among others. His belief is that, “whatever I may do, my debt to my country will always remain in debt.” Mr. Padmanabha says that every situation appears as a challenge to me rather than induce fear. We spoke about work which he is doing with his friend Mr. Venkatasubba Rao They are trying to create a better place for students studying in government schools.
